Abstract

The invention relates to an emergency communication method of a wireless cell phone and a wireless local area network and a communication device. The communication method comprises the following steps: (1) under normal condition, a communication system is in general communication mode, if the communication system detects that a general communication link fails, the communication system is switched into an emergency communication mode; if the communication system detects that the failures of the general communication link are eliminated, the communication system is switched back to the general communication mode; (2) under normal condition, the communication system is in general communication mode, if an authorized user starts the emergency communication mode, the communication system is switched into the emergency communication mode; if the authorized user closes the emergency communication mode, the communication system is switched back to the general communication mode; and (3) under normal condition, the communication system is powered by an external power supply, if the external power supply fails, the communication system is switched into a standby power supply; if the failures of the external power supply are eliminated, the communication system is switched back to the external power supply. The emergency communication method and the communication device solve the problem of communication between wireless users under emergency conditions.

Background technology
Earthquake is to one of maximum natural calamity of human security harm, and China is located between circum-Pacific seismic belt and the Eurasian earthquake zone, is one of country that seismic activity in the world is the strongest and earthquake disaster is the most serious.7%th, 20 century global continent 35% the earthquake more than 7.0 grades that China accounts for global land surface occurs in China; The dead 1,200,000 philtrum China of 20th century earthquake account for 590,000, occupy first of the various countries.According to " national protection against and mitigation of earthquake disasters planning (2006-2020) ", most of area, China's Mainland is positioned at the above zone of earthquake intensity VI degree; 50% area is positioned at the above territory, earthquake highly seismic region of VII degree, the above big city (the earthquake risk as Beijing, Xi'an, Chengdu, packet header, Tangshan is all relatively large) of million people's mouth that comprises 23 provincial capitals and 2/3, the potential threat of earthquake is huge.Along with the quickening of National urban degree, urban population sharply increases, and violent earthquake causes the risk of huge personnel and building disaster definitely should pay much attention to.
After special disaster such as earthquake takes place, ensure the emergency communication of disaster area policy-making body, guarantee that central authorities, local governments at various levels and commanding agency's running are significant to the disaster relief.Under the existence conditions, after disasters such as earthquake take place, the disaster area power failure, common fixed network is communicated by letter with wireless network and is become extremely unreliable, communication disruption such as landline telephone, mobile phone, Personal Handyphone System, the Internet are all inevitable, cause many places, especially many intensive relatively township, town and even county towns of population become " isolated island " that shuts off oneself from society, and then cause accident rescue command's door to collapse not clear with human mortality's the condition of a disaster to the isolated regional architecture thing of communicating by letter, influence carrying out of rescue work, had influence on the unified plan of government.
With Wenchuan, Sichuan on the 12nd May in 2008 8 grades of special violent earthquake disasters taking place is example, and this earthquake causes the communication disruption of overlarge area, is the communication disruption of overlarge area for the second time on old China hand's trustworthy historical record after the southern ice and snow disaster at the beginning of year 08.After disaster took place, Sichuan, Gansu domestic some areas communication were had a strong impact on, and communicated by letter and interrupt comprehensively in a plurality of severely afflicated areas at county level such as (isolated above 48 hours with external information), Wenchuan.At the disaster relief initial stage, the main channel that obtains information has only Aba state government website.Have only by indivedual marine satellite phones and Aba state government and disaster area are got in touch.Earthquake took place after many days, and the communication in many disaster areas is still interrupted.The communication issue that the 8 grades of special violent earthquake disasters in Wenchuan cause, be fail to set up can be after calamity effective emergency communication system, cause the condition of a disaster to fail in time to distinguish, disaster relief sluggishness in some areas is suffered heavy losses.Simultaneously, after the earthquake, because seismic monitoring data interruption based on wire communication, the earthquake region earthquake is surveyed shake and can't in time be transmitted or lose with the macroseism Monitoring Data, causing earthquake generation development and earthquake disaster to influence situation does not have telemetry, influences the scientific and reasonable of the quick judgement of disaster and the disaster relief.
It is directly that catastrophe such as earthquake generation back fixed network is broken off, and also is inevitable, and also can breaks off based on the up radio communication of fixed network, and reason is returned and studied carefully the problem that exists in its existing wireless communications technology that adopts:
What (1) wireless cell phone communication such as GSM, CDMA, WCDMA at present and wireless LAN communication adopted is that the wireless base station adds mode wired or that microwave is up, its data feedback channel is owing to be confined to adopt copper cable, optical cable, perhaps microwave, when major disaster takes place, copper cable, optical cable and microwave station all may wreck, any radio reception device all can't independently be finished cut-in operation in conventional system, cause communication to carry out.
(2) at present in wireless cell phone communications such as GSM, CDMA, WCDMA and wireless LAN communication, the commanding to government emergency department does not give Special Empower, major disaster or big assembly process take place in, because all ruthless pre-emptions of all users, can cause communication to block up, emergency command information and important communication can't be carried out, and the work of government maybe can't be launched by retardation.
(3) wireless cell phone communication such as GSM, CDMA, WCDMA at present or do not have back-up source, or back-up source off-capacity, the back-up source kind is limited, is not enough to deal with the powerup issue of extreme case.A kind of in the back situation, in case lose external power source, back-up source can only of short durationly be powered.Present wireless LAN communication is not more considered the back-up source problem.

Embodiment
Below with reference to accompanying drawing embodiments of the invention are described.
Wireless cell phone and WLAN (wireless local area network) emergency communication method comprise the steps:
(1) communication system is in general communication pattern (as by communications such as optical cables, copper cable, microwave) under the normal condition, if when detecting the general communication link and breaking down (as the destruction earthquake), then communication system is switched to the emergency communication pattern; If when detecting the elimination of general communication link failure, then communication system is switched back to the general communication pattern.
The fault detection method of described general communication up link is: the fault of uplink communication link comprises multiple situations such as communication information integrality, communication disruption, if communication system is found the relevant signaling in the Operation and maintenance link and the chain rupture alarm occurred, so just judge that outage has appearred in the uplink communication link, communication system is automatically switched to the emergency communication pattern or the notified on authorization user switches to the emergency communication pattern with it.After communication system judges that uplink communication link down fault is eliminated, be the general communication pattern with communication system automatic switchover or notified on authorization user manual switching.
(2) communication system regularly detects automatically to standby satellite communication link.
Communication system regularly detects automatically to standby satellite communication link: regularly to the satellites transmits detecting information, described detecting information returns ground via satellite, and described communication system is understood the detecting information that returns; If the detecting information that returns is consistent with the detecting information that sends, judge that then satellite communication link is normal; Otherwise, if the detecting information that returns is inconsistent with the detecting information that sends, judge that then satellite communication link breaks down, send trouble hunting information.
Described communication system satellite communication link database in can be provided with talk times, the duration of call.
(3) communication system is in the general communication pattern under the normal condition, if authorized user starts the emergency communication pattern, then communication system switches to the emergency communication pattern; If authorized user is closed the emergency communication pattern, then communication system switches to the general communication pattern.
Communication system is carried out the Special Empower management to the user, after described communication system switches to the emergency communication pattern, preferentially to authorized user or only to authorized user open communication business.
Described communication system is carried out the Special Empower management to the user: import authorization user information in the database of communication system in advance; Under the emergency communication pattern, communication control module is compared the communication request and the predefined authorization user information of database that receive, if belong to the communication request that authorized user sends, then ensure this user's communications demand, its concrete way to manage is similar to the pre-payment mobile phone (has telephone expenses then to serve, the then forced interruption conversation of no telephone expenses, different is the inefficacy of avoiding wired system, authorization data all is stored in the radio access station communication control module).When described authorized user is the wireless cell phone user, by wireless cell phone user's the SIM card and the database comparison of described communication system are carried out the authorized user identities authentication, when described authorized user is wireless local network user, carry out the authorized user authentication by username and password etc.
(4) communication system is powered by external power supply under the normal condition, if when detecting external power supply and breaking down, then communication system is switched to stand-by power supply; If when detecting the external power supply fault recovery, then communication system is switched back to external power supply.
Wireless cell phone and WLAN (wireless local area network) emergency communication device are as shown in Figure 1.This communicator comprises wireless user's (cell phone, radio networking device), radio reception device (antenna for base station, WiMAX WIFI antenna, cell phone system, router or other Ethernet equipment), communication control module, satellite communication equipment, satellite, energy supply control module and stand-by power supply.The wireless user is used for proposing the wireless access request to radio reception device; Radio reception device is judged the wireless access request that receives wireless user's proposition, controls its communication by communication control module; Whether communication control module is used to detect communication link and breaks down, the switching between the control communication pattern, and the communication of control radio reception device and the communication of satellite communication equipment; Satellite communication equipment is controlled by communication control module, is used to connect communicating by letter between radio reception device and the satellite; Satellite is responsible for connecting the destination or the terrestrial repetition station of wireless access request, and satellite adopts ChinaStar-1 (satellite that possesses communication function all can, as marine satellite, iridium satellite etc.) in the present embodiment; Whether energy supply control module is used to detect external power supply and breaks down, the switching between control communication system power supply; Stand-by power supply has the ultra-delay performance, can communication system that supports work more than 3 days.
Described general communication link is optical cable, copper cable or microwave communications link, and described emergency satellite communication link comprises satellite communication equipment and satellite.Satellite communication equipment adopts German ND SatCom company to produce in the present embodiment IDU 7000 SERIES (the similar functions product of other company also can), signaling interface can adopt E1/T1 (G.703)/ISDN BRI for voice/data/PRI or Dual-Ethernet interface.
Communication control module is controlled switching of this communication system uplink communication link, energy supply control module is controlled switching of this communication system power supply, antenna for base station is responsible for inserting wireless cell phone, the WIFI antenna is responsible for inserting wireless local network user, cell phone system generally includes the base station to second generation communication system, base station controllers etc. provide the part of service for wireless cell phone, router or other Ethernet equipment provide service for wireless local network user, UPS is interchange with the storage battery dc inversion, battery monitor monitoring battery-operated state, controller for solar arrives storage battery with the power storage of solar cell output.
When communication control module detects the general communication link and breaks down, the wireless user proposes the wireless access request to radio reception device, after described radio reception device receives the wireless access request, judge whether described wireless user is authorized user, if, then radio reception device receives the wireless access request, and communication equipment connects satellite via satellite, is connected the destination of wireless access request or is transferred to the destination through the terrestrial repetition station by described satellite; If not, then radio reception device refusal wireless access request; When communication control module detects the elimination of general communication link failure, communication system is switched back to the general communication pattern.Access process as shown in Figure 2.
Communication control module regularly detects automatically to the satellite communication link that is made of satellite communication equipment and satellite: the regular trace routine of establishment in communication control module, described communication control module every day (as some every days 9) is to satellites transmits link test information, described detecting information returns ground via satellite, and described communication system is understood the detecting information that returns; If the detecting information that returns is consistent with the detecting information that sends, judge that then satellite communication link is normal; Otherwise, if the detecting information that returns is inconsistent with the detecting information that sends, judge that then satellite communication link breaks down, send trouble hunting information.
When energy supply control module detects external power supply and breaks down, communication system is switched to stand-by power supply; When energy supply control module detects the external power supply fault recovery, communication system is switched back to external power supply.
The detection method of described power failure is: energy supply control module when back-up system operate as normal (be lower than 200V, can not) when detecting external power supply and drop into to a certain degree as civil power, think that promptly external power supply breaks down, and realize the seamless automatic switchover of power supply; Energy supply control module is when detecting external power supply voltage in a period of time and be raised to a certain degree, think that promptly external power supply recovers, automatically the switchback external power supply (is similar on line type UPS, but can realize management, and can and realize manual intervention) with the central control system swap data to multiple electric source modes such as solar energy, generators.
As shown in Figure 3, the stand-by power supply of present embodiment is the combination (stand-by power supply also can be any among storage battery, solar cell, generator, the uninterrupted power supply UPS) of batteries, solar panel, generating set and uninterrupted power supply UPS.Described batteries is by the control of battery monitor device, and described solar panel is controlled by controller for solar.The STP175S-24/Ab-1 that solar panel adopts STP Utilities Electric Co. to produce, the Hipulse that UPS adopts Emerson Network Power CO., Ltd to produce.
